Abstract

A method may include receiving, by a transceiver, an upload content from a device among a plurality of devices, determining, by a controller, use conditions associated with each of the plurality of devices, forming a group of more than one device among the plurality of devices, based on the upload content and the use conditions; and transmitting, by the transceiver, the upload content to the group of more than one device simultaneously.
